Introduction to Artificial Decoration Trees
Artificial decoration trees, often referred to as faux trees, have become a popular choice for home and office decor. They provide the aesthetic appeal of natural trees without the maintenance and mess associated with real ones. From seasonal decorations to year-round decor, these trees offer versatility and convenience.
Benefits of Choosing Artificial Decoration Trees
Low Maintenance
One of the biggest advantages of artificial trees is their low maintenance requirements. Unlike real trees, they do not need watering, regular pruning, or sunlight. This makes them ideal for busy individuals or those without a green thumb.
Allergy-Friendly
For individuals sensitive to pollen or certain tree types, artificial trees provide an excellent alternative. They can enhance the decor without triggering allergies, making them suitable for homes with allergy sufferers.
Longevity and Durability
Artificial decoration trees are designed to last, often remaining vibrant and appealing for years. Quality faux trees are made from durable materials that can withstand various environmental conditions, whether displayed indoors or outdoors.
Types of Artificial Decoration Trees
Seasonal Trees
Seasonal artificial trees, such as Christmas trees, are a staple during the holiday season. They come in various styles, from traditional pine to modern designs, and can be adorned with lights and ornaments to create a festive atmosphere.
Indoor Trees
Indoor artificial trees, like ficus or rubber trees, can enhance any living space. They add a touch of nature while complementing interior design themes, providing an inviting ambiance.
Outdoor Trees
Outdoor artificial trees, made from weather-resistant materials, are perfect for enhancing gardens or patios. They maintain their appearance without fading or wilting, allowing for consistent decor year-round.
How to Choose the Right Artificial Decoration Tree
Size and Space Considerations
When selecting an artificial tree, consider the dimensions of the space where it will be placed. A large tree can serve as a striking focal point, while smaller options can fit neatly in corners or on shelves.
Style and Design
Your choice of style should reflect your personal taste and interior design. Whether modern, rustic, or traditional, there are countless options available to suit any aesthetic.
Quality and Price
Investing in a high-quality artificial tree may require a bigger upfront cost, but it often pays off in durability and appearance. Look for trees with realistic foliage and sturdy construction for the best results.
